The IndoSurgicals ICU Bed with ABS Panel and ABS Safety Rails is designed for healthcare facilities that need multiple patient-positioning functions without depending on an electrically powered actuator system.
Its four-section patient platform is supported by a robust rectangular M.S. tubular framework. Separate mechanical screw controls operated from the foot end provide backrest, knee-rest and Hi-Lo adjustment.
ABS moulded head and foot panels, tuck-away ABS side rails, a telescopic IV rod and castor-mounted construction add practical bedside features for intensive-care and other appropriate hospital environments.
SKU 10004 is a mechanically adjustable Hi-Lo ICU bed. The principal patient-positioning functions are operated through separate screw mechanisms rather than electric actuators.
This gives the bed more positioning flexibility than a plain hospital bed or basic Semi Fowler model while keeping its published adjustment system mechanical.
It is particularly relevant where a hospital requires adjustable backrest, knee-rest and bed height together with ABS end panels, tuck-away safety rails and mobile castor-mounted construction.

The mattress-support area consists of a four-section top manufactured from perforated M.S. sheet.
Dividing the platform into sections allows the backrest and knee-rest portions to move as part of the mechanical adjustment system.
The perforated construction forms a structured metal support surface beneath an appropriate patient mattress.
The two ends of the ICU bed use ABS moulded head and foot panels.
ABS provides a formed panel construction that gives the bed a different appearance and handling characteristics from models using open stainless-steel tubular bows or laminated metal-framed end panels.
Formed ABS end panels provide a clean, integrated head-and-foot-panel configuration.
ABS components should be cleaned using procedures and agents compatible with the material and the facility's infection-control requirements.
The ICU bed incorporates ABS tuck-away safety side railings along the patient platform.
When positioned for use, side rails provide a physical boundary alongside the mattress platform. Their tuck-away design allows greater bedside access when the rails are appropriately lowered.
The published bed specification includes a telescopic IV rod with two provision locations.
The available mounting points allow the IV rod to be positioned according to patient access, room arrangement and bedside-equipment requirements.
The bed is mounted on four 125 mm diameter castors, allowing appropriate movement and repositioning within the hospital.
According to the published specification, two castors are fitted with a braking system to help stabilise the bed when it is positioned for patient use.
Castor-mounted construction helps staff reposition the bed when required for room arrangement, cleaning or patient-care activities.
Two braked castors provide the published mechanism for stabilising the bed while stationary.

| Product Name | ICU Bed with ABS Panel and ABS Safety Rails |
|---|---|
| Product Code / SKU | 10004 |
| Brand | IS IndoSurgicals® |
| Product Type | Mechanical / Manual Hi-Lo ICU Hospital Bed |
| Framework | Rectangular M.S. tube |
| Patient Platform | Four-section perforated M.S. sheet top |
| Backrest Adjustment | Separate screw mechanism from foot end |
| Knee-Rest Adjustment | Separate screw mechanism from foot end |
| Hi-Lo Adjustment | Mechanical screw-operated adjustment |
| Head & Foot Panels | ABS moulded |
| Safety Side Rails | ABS tuck-away design |
| IV Rod | Telescopic |
| IV Rod Locations | Two |
| Castors | Four × 125 mm diameter |
| Braking System | Brakes on two castors |
| Overall Length | 210 cm |
| Overall Width | 90 cm |
| Adjustable Height | 60–80 cm |
| Overall Size | 210 cm (L) × 90 cm (W) × 60–80 cm (H) |
| Finish | Epoxy powder coated |
| Suitable For | Intensive-care units, high-dependency areas, hospitals, healthcare institutions and institutional procurement |
